A New Fragrance Chapter
SETCHU has unveiled a quintet of perfumes designed to bridge Japanese tradition and Western olfactory craftsmanship. Framed as “tailored origamis,” each scent corresponds to a specific hour, from Monday 9 a.m. through Saturday 8 a.m., inviting wearers to explore harmony, balance and personal expression.
The Scents
From the burnt-rice warmth of Genmaicha Morning to the clean, marble-like purity of Hinoki Ritual, SETCHU offers five distinct compositions meant to ease, seduce and energize across every moment of the day and night. “MONDAY 9 AM | GENMAICHA” combines roasted-rice accord and green-tea extract with Italian bergamot and cardamom for a mindful start. “WEDNESDAY 5 PM | YUZU” pairs nostalgic yuzu extract and pink pepper with incense and musks for tranquil midweek zest. “THURSDAY 1 PM | AYU” nods to lakeside fishing with salty seaweed and Mediterranean solar notes. “FRIDAY 2 AM | TATAMI” layers cereal and igusa accords with Havana wood and sandalwood to evoke nocturnal intimacy. Closing the series, “SATURDAY 8 AM | HINOKI BURO” captures the serenity of a hinoki-wood bathhouse at dawn.
